We anticipate most users to create their own meta units. 

Here are some of the current ways you can do it but we hope to get feedback on other ways:

1. Player selects units, right-clicks on another unit to have it join that meta.

2. Player selects a unit and has units constructed and sent to it to join a unit.

3. Player drag selects a bunch of units, creates a control group and units not currently in a meta unit are put in one as best the game can (non ideal but better than nothing).

Other things we are considering but are not promising (scope cost) are being able to design meta units outside the game and then being able to, in game, select a unit and choose a meta unit design and have the types of units that have been considered show up as icons that the player can select and have built and/or unassociated units attach to.
